An autonomous underwater vehicle (AUV) is a device that has a power source and fully automatically observes the sea along a predetermined route.Until now, it has demonstrated its capabilities in seafloor photography and acoustic surveys, and has brought new discoveries to seafloor surveys, but in deep seas where the communication environment is poor, it is not possible to collect (sample) seafloor organisms and minerals. Has been a long-standing issue.

 This time, the research group led by the Graduate School of Biomedical Engineering / Social Robot Realization Center of Kyushu Institute of Technology and the Underwater Observation and Mounting Engineering Research Center of the Institute of Industrial Science, University of Tokyo has launched the AUV "TUNA-SAND2", which specializes in sampling. It was developed and succeeded in fully automatic biological sampling in the natural environment off Shimizu.

 TUNA-SAND2 is a hovering type AUV with a total length of 1.4 m and a weight of 380 kg.It is equipped with a 3D mapping device that can map the seabed in three dimensions, and a camera for detecting organisms that live on the seabed. Since its completion in 3, it has been used for the Sea of ​​Okhotsk Fisheries Resources Survey and the coral reef survey at the bottom of Okinawa, and has been successful in image mapping.

 After that, TUNA-SAND2 has strengthened the sampling function.When information on the species to be captured is given, an image of the seafloor is taken with the on-board camera, and the image judged to be the organism to be sampled is transmitted to researchers on board by acoustic communication.If you specify the target image from the sent images, it will return to the shooting position and sample the target creature.By repeating this series of processes, fully automatic sampling was successful.

 In resource surveys and scientific surveys, not only image and acoustic data but also actual samples are indispensable. By realizing fully automatic image shooting and fully automatic sampling by AUV, it is expected that it will be possible to investigate the resource reserve efficiently and with high accuracy in the future.
